Ticket: Configuration drift detected on the Farecrest rules engine (shipping fees). The staging node in the Ostmere cluster is applying a stale surcharge table, so quotes there differ from production by roughly 4%. Support should not hand-edit rules to compensate; drifted values will be overwritten at next sync. We will reconcile tonight and re-run the fee regression suite. For reference, the expected configuration values are listed below.

config for bagep-kageg:
ULADOR_LOG_LEVEL=warn
ULADOR_METRICS_HOST=metrics.ulador.tolvaqcorp.corp
ULADOR_POOL_SIZE=32

## Escalation — RenderBarn transcoding farm

Quick refresher for the sync: if the RenderBarn queue depth stays above 5k for 15 minutes, first bounce the stuck workers via the `barn-sweep` script. Still wedged? Page whoever's on the Frayton media rotation. If encode errors spike alongside queue growth, it's probably the codec license daemon again — that one goes to Priya Okonde's crew. For anything messier, just email the farm's escalation inbox and someone will grab it.

alerts address for bajop-yahog: istwyn@lumiclabs.internal

## Chronosync Environments

Plugin authors targeting the Chronosync staging environment should be aware of a known calendar sync conflict: recurring events edited in the Lumenday client may briefly produce duplicate entries until the reconciliation worker completes its pass. Do not retry writes during this window, as it compounds the conflict. To configure your plugin against staging correctly, use the environment values listed below.

service settings:
PRAIX_LOG_LEVEL=error
PRAIX_METRICS_HOST=metrics.praix.qorvelcorp.corp
PRAIX_POOL_SIZE=16

Welcome to the Pelmont data team! Our golden rule: schema migrations never lock tables. We use the expand-contract pattern — add the new column, dual-write from Quillhorn services, backfill in batches, then drop the old column a full release later. Never rename in place, and never ship a migration and its code change in the same deploy. Sounds tedious, but it's saved us from at least three outages. Step-by-step checklists with examples are on the internal page below.

dashboard of kafop-yagep = https://jira.zemvarsys.internal/pages/pages/pages/display/cc87